Aker Solutions ASA with LEI 5967007LIEEXZXG42836 (the "Company")
Potential Buy-Back of AKSO03 Float 07/25/22 with ISIN NO0010814213 (the "AKSO Bonds")
DNB Markets, a part of DNB Bank ASA Skandinaviska Enskilda Banken AB (publ), Oslo Branch ("Managers") 11 March 2022
Offer: By submitting this bondholders offer form (the "Bondholders Offer Form") to the Managers before the "reverse Dutch auction" deadline 16:00 CET 15 March 2022 (the "Submission Deadline"), the (A) direct registered owner or nominee with respect to the Bonds (as defined below) covered by this Bondholders Offer Form (a "Bondholder"); or (B) beneficial owner of the Bonds (as defined below) covered by this Bondholders Offer Form where a nominee holder is registered as a bondholder (a "Beneficial Owner of Bonds") irrevocably commits itself to sell the bonds specified in the table below (the "Bonds") to the Company, according to the terms and conditions of this Bondholders Offer Form (the "Offer"). Once a duly executed Bondholders Offer Form has been submitted, the Offer is binding and irrevocable for the Bondholder or the Beneficial Owner of Bonds, as the case may be, until the Company's deadline for acceptance at 16:00 CET 15 March 2022, and may until such time not be withdrawn or modified or altered by the Bondholder or the Beneficial Owner of Bonds, as the case may be, and the Bondholder or the Beneficial Owner of Bonds, as the case may be, may not until such time sell, transfer or encumber the Bonds subject to this Bondholders Offer Form. The Company is under no obligation to accept any Offer from any Bondholder or any Beneficial Owner of Bonds, as the case may be.
If the Company accepts the Bondholder's or Beneficial Owner of Bonds' Offer, the Bonds will be transferred to the Company based on the Bondholder's or the Beneficial Owner of Bonds', as the case may be, instructions to the Managers in this Bondholder Offer Form (and without obtaining any further instructions from the Bondholder or the Beneficial Owner of Bonds, as the case may be,). The result of the "reverse Dutch auction", i.e. whether the Company will buy back any of the AKSO Bonds or not and, in case, which Offers the Company will accept based on the Offer price submitted, will be announced at the latest 09:00 CET 16 March 2022, but not before the Submission Deadline. The Company will only communicate acceptance of Offers (if any) through a stock exchange announcement of which the buy-back price (the "Buy-Back Price") and consequently the total amount of AKSO Bonds to be repurchased (if any). Bondholders or Beneficial Owners of Bonds, as the case may be, with offers equalling the Buy-Back Price or lower will receive the Buy-Back Price multiplied with the number of Bonds offered, but the Company may in its sole discretion reduce the number of Bonds to be acquired on a pro rata basis, but not lower than a minimum threshold of NOK 1,000,000 (denomination) for Bonds offered at the Buy Back Price for each offering Bondholder or Beneficial Owner of Bonds, as the case may be. The Company may, in its sole discretion, waive, extend, terminate, withdraw, or increase the size of the buy-back at any time.
Cash settlement of Bonds accepted by the Company for purchase is expected to take place on 18 March 2022, unless settlement is delayed due to technical and/or administrative errors. The Company will pay the buy-back price together with accrued unpaid interest (if any) for the period up to but excluding the settlement date.
